Flow123d  3.9.0-3aaaea010
MeshBase Member List

This is the complete list of members for MeshBase, including all inherited members.

add_element_to_vector(int id, bool is_boundary=false)MeshBaseprotected
bc_mesh() const =0MeshBasepure virtual
boundary(uint edge_idx) const =0MeshBasepure virtual
canonical_faces()MeshBaseprotected
check_compatible_mesh(Mesh &input_mesh)=0MeshBasepure virtual
check_element_size(unsigned int elem_idx) constMeshBaseinline
create_node_element_lists()MeshBaseprotected
DECLARE_EXCEPTION(ExcTooMatchingIds,<< "Mesh: Duplicate dim-join lower dim elements: "<< EI_ElemId::val<< ", "<< EI_ElemIdOther::val<< ".\n")MeshBase
duplicate_nodes() constMeshBaseinline
duplicate_nodes_MeshBaseprotected
Edge classMeshBasefriend
edge(uint edge_idx) constMeshBase
edge_range() constMeshBase
edgesMeshBaseprotected
el_4_locMeshBaseprotected
el_dsMeshBaseprotected
elem_index(int elem_id) constMeshBaseinline
elem_permutation_MeshBaseprotected
element(unsigned idx) constMeshBaseinline
Element classMeshBasefriend
element_accessor(unsigned int idx) constMeshBase
element_ids_MeshBaseprotected
element_nodes_original_MeshBaseprotected
element_permutations() constMeshBaseinline
element_vec_MeshBaseprotected
ElementAccessor classMeshBasefriend
elements_range() constMeshBase
find_elem_id(unsigned int pos) constMeshBaseinline
find_lower_dim_element(vector< unsigned int > &element_list, unsigned int dim, unsigned int &element_idx)MeshBaseprotected
find_node_id(unsigned int pos) constMeshBaseinline
get_el_4_loc() constMeshBaseinline
get_el_ds() constMeshBaseinline
get_local_part()=0MeshBasepure virtual
get_part()=0MeshBasepure virtual
get_row_4_el() constMeshBaseinline
get_side_nodes(unsigned int dim, unsigned int side) constMeshBaseinline
init_element_vector(unsigned int size)MeshBase
init_node_vector(unsigned int size)MeshBase
intersect_element_lists(vector< unsigned int > const &nodes_list, vector< unsigned int > &intersection_element_list)MeshBase
max_edge_sides(unsigned int dim) constMeshBaseinline
max_edge_sides_MeshBaseprotected
MeshBase()MeshBase
n_edges() constMeshBaseinline
n_elements() constMeshBaseinline
n_nodes() constMeshBaseinline
n_vb_neighbours() constMeshBase
node(unsigned int idx) constMeshBase
node_elements()MeshBase
node_elements_MeshBase
node_ids_MeshBaseprotected
node_permutation_MeshBaseprotected
node_permutations() constMeshBaseinline
node_range() constMeshBase
NodeAccessor classMeshBasefriend
nodes_MeshBaseprotected
region_db() constMeshBaseinline
region_db_MeshBaseprotected
row_4_elMeshBaseprotected
same_sides(const SideIter &si, vector< unsigned int > &side_nodes)MeshBaseprotected
side_nodesMeshBase
TYPEDEF_ERR_INFO(EI_ElemId, int)MeshBase
TYPEDEF_ERR_INFO(EI_ElemIdOther, int)MeshBase
undef_idxMeshBasestatic
vb_neighbour(unsigned int nb) constMeshBase
vb_neighbours_MeshBaseprotected
~MeshBase()MeshBasevirtual